YakGear Yak Stick Stake-Out Stick
Best shallow water anchoring tool for kayak anglers seeking stability.
This essential tool provides a silent, reliable way to secure a small craft in shallow water without the noise of traditional metal anchors. Its buoyant design ensures it won't sink if dropped, while the dual-purpose handle allows for both anchoring and maneuvering in tight spots.

Performance breakdown
Anchoring stability
Fiberglass shaft provides a rigid hold in soft mud and sand.
Buoyancy reliability
Engineered to float, eliminating the stress of losing gear overboard.
Handling ergonomics
Oversized foam grip ensures comfort during long days of poling.
Versatility
Seamlessly transitions between a stake-out pole and a shallow-water push pole.
Build durability
Pultrusion-formed fiberglass resists flexing and withstands harsh saltwater environments.
Portability
Lightweight construction makes it easy to stow on smaller kayak decks.
Key Specs
Material
Fiberglass shaft with nylon handle and pick
Weight
1.375 lbs
Length
75 inches
Diameter
0.875 inches
Color
Black
Warranty
1 year
Buoyant
Yes
